#a34c06 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a34c06 is composed of 63.9% red, 29.8%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.4% magenta, 96.3%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 26.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.9% and a lightness of 33.1%. #a34c06 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ff980c with #470000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#a34c06 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].

#a34c06 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a34c06 has RGB values of R:163, G:76,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.96,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10701830.

Shades and Tints of #a34c06

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0500 is the darkest color, while #fffb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a34c06

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555454 is the less saturated color, while #a34c06 is the most saturated one.
